Task Completion Chaos: Ever feel like finishing a task is as elusive as a unicorn riding a rainbow? You're not alone! Join Amy and Megan as they dive into the wild world of task completion for neurodivergent minds.In this episode, our hosts get real about:
The struggle of starting a podcast recording (spoiler: it took 10 minutes!) How parenting throws a wrench in even the simplest tasks (coffee, anyone?) The dreaded "task limbo" and why it's so hard to escape Creating "recipe cards" for life's repetitive tasks (because who can remember all those steps?) The unexpected emotions that pop up when you finally finish somethingFrom holiday card sagas to the mysteries of dopamine kicks, Amy and Megan explore the highs, lows, and in-betweens of getting stuff done. They even dabble with an AI coaching bot named Shuffle – because sometimes you need a digital cheerleader in your pocket!Whether you're neurotypical or your brain likes to color outside the lines, this episode is a comforting reminder that we're all just trying to adult one task at a time. So grab your favorite unfinished project and tune in for some laughs, insights, and maybe even a motivation boost to tackle that to-do list!
